Among the content released in the Half-Life 2 leak, was a Valve employee's copy of Half-Life and a few other miscellaneous addons, including an early version of the yet to be released Condition Zero.

Under the name of "cstrike_trs", this covers the "offline matches with bots" portion of Condition Zero that was developed by Turtle Rock Studios. However, there are notably several leftovers from the previous developers, as well as cut content from the Xbox port of Counter-Strike.

General Differences

Main Menu

The main menu in this prototype uses the original Counter-Strike menu background.

Tour of Duty

The Tour of Duty single-player mode is present, though the maps in each tour are different.

Player Models

  • Elite Crew is entirely different.

  • The prototype lacks the Spetsnaz and Midwest Militia playermodels.

Weapons

All weapons reuse the Counter-Strike 1.6 models in this prototype.

Health Bug

For some reason, the damage models in this prototype seem to be completely random: at times, you will need more shots than usual to kill bots and vice versa.
